THE A64 was closed this afternoon following a car crash.
The crash, involving a car and an HGV, took place between Willerby and Staxton at the B1249 crossroads.

A police spokesperson said that the A64 was closed but was re-opened a few hours later. They added that an air ambulance attended.
Fire services said that crews from Scarborough and Sherburn attended the collision involving a car and a heavy goods vehicle.
"When crews arrived on scene the driver of the HGV was out of the vehicle," they said.
"The driver of the car was being assisted by the paramedics on scene and they were able to help the driver out of the car to receive further treatment.
"The crews made the area safe and left the scene in the hands of the paramedics."
